Waggoner RV Park boasts a highly desirable location at 220 Ln 425B Jimmerson Lake, Fremont, IN 46737, USA. This address places it directly on the shores of Jimmerson Lake, one of the interconnected chain of lakes that define Steuben County in northeastern Indiana. This region is a true gem for outdoor enthusiasts, offering a plethora of water-based activities and scenic beauty.
Jimmerson Lake itself is a vital part of the larger Lake James chain, which includes James, Snow, and Crooked lakes. This interconnectedness allows for extensive boating, fishing, and watersports across a significant body of water, making it a dream for those who own or rent boats. Jimmerson Lake is known for its excellent fishing, with dominant catches including bass, catfish, and panfish, and also habitat for walleye, bluegill, and crappie. The presence of a public boat launch on the north side of the lake makes it convenient for both residents and visitors to access the water.
Accessibility to Waggoner RV Park from various parts of Indiana is straightforward due to its proximity to major highways. Fremont, the town where the park is located, is just a short drive off Interstate 69 (I-69), a primary north-south artery in Indiana.
-
From Fort Wayne: The drive is approximately 45 minutes to 1 hour, heading north on I-69.
-
From Indianapolis: Expect a journey of about 2 to 2.5 hours, primarily via I-69 North.
-
From South Bend: The park is roughly 1.5 to 2 hours away.
This ease of access means that Indiana locals can quickly transition from their daily routines to a tranquil lakeside setting without an overly long commute. The nearby towns of Fremont and Angola offer essential amenities such as grocery stores, gas stations, and local dining options, ensuring that campers have convenient access to supplies and services while enjoying their stay by the lake.
